- Do I need to be a Salesforce Administrator first?
- Yes. The Salesforce Certified Administrator credential is a prerequisite for the Sales Cloud Consultant certification. You have to hold the active Administrator certification first, then build on it with Sales Cloud implementation experience. Salesforce recommends two to five years of hands-on experience implementing Sales Cloud, typically as a senior business analyst or consultant, before you sit this exam.
- How many questions is the exam and how long is it?
- The exam has 60 scored multiple choice and multiple select questions, plus up to five unscored questions, and you get 105 minutes. Registration is US$200 plus applicable tax, and a retake is US$100. It is delivered onsite at a test center or online with remote proctoring, and no reference materials are allowed. Salesforce also refreshes exam content with each release, so features from both Lightning Experience and Salesforce Classic can appear.
- What is the passing score?
- Salesforce does not headline a passing score on the current credential page, and the figures that circulate sit around 68 to 69 percent. Treat any exact number as approximate rather than official, because Salesforce reports the result as pass or fail. The dependable approach is to be strong across all five topic areas, especially the practical application topic that carries a third of the exam, rather than aiming for a specific percentage.
- What does the current exam cover?
- The exam was restructured in 2024 into five topic areas: practical application of Sales Cloud expertise around 33 percent, sales lifecycle around 23 percent, implementation strategies around 15 percent, data management around 15 percent, and consulting practices around 14 percent. Those weights total 100 percent. Note that Salesforce's downloadable study guide PDF still shows the older nine-section structure, so use the live exam guide to confirm the current outline before you study.
- Why do different sites list different exam sections?
- Because Salesforce restructured the outline in 2024 and its own downloadable study guide has not caught up. The PDF Salesforce hosts is an older edition with nine sections, while the current live guide uses five topic areas. Older prep sites copied the nine-section version, so you will see both circulating. Study the current five-topic outline, and be skeptical of any material that still lists the old section names and weights.
- Is Sales Cloud Consultant being renamed to Agentforce Sales Consultant?
- Yes. On July 24, 2026 the Salesforce Certified Sales Cloud Consultant credential becomes the Salesforce Certified Agentforce Sales Consultant. It is one of 16 certifications Salesforce is renaming that day to match current product naming. The change is cosmetic: exam content, outline, and fees are unchanged, you do not re-earn anything, and Trailblazer profiles update automatically. Only your resume wording needs attention.
- Is the certification worth it?
- For consultants and senior business analysts who implement Sales Cloud, yes. It is the credential that signals you can translate a sales organization's process into a working Salesforce implementation, not just administer the platform. It pairs naturally with the Administrator certification it requires and with the Service Cloud Consultant credential for teams that own both clouds. If your work is platform configuration rather than implementation consulting, the Advanced Administrator certification may fit better.
